What artificial intelligence really means
Artificial intelligence refers to systems designed to perform tasks that normally involve:
• learning
• decision making
• pattern recognition
• problem solving

Instead of being directly programmed for every single situation, AI systems are often designed to analyze information, recognize patterns, and make predictions or decisions based on data.
That is what makes AI different from simple automation.

Where we already see AI
AI already exists in many tools and services people use every day, including:
• recommendation systems on streaming platforms
• navigation and traffic apps
• spam filters in email
• voice assistants
• fraud detection systems
• facial recognition technology
• search engines
• customer support chat systems

Many people use AI regularly without even realizing it.
